Aoashi tells the story of young Ashito Aoi in his third year at Ehime City Middle School and his meeting with football coach Tatsuya Fukuda. Ashito, although talented, is a difficult boy, but Fukuda believes in him and invites him to join his own team. Ashito could well change the face of Japanese football. Based on an idea by Naohiko Ueno, Ao Ashi is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Yugo Kobayashi. Since January 2015, it has been published in Shogakukan's seinen manga magazine Weekly Big Comic Spirits. In May 2021, Production IG announced that they would make an anime version, which ran from April to September 2022.

Aoashi starts offseemingly following the same formula - but after several chapters, it immediately differentiates itself with amazing character depth. Ashito is a great main character: he balances the great energy and determination of main characters you find in other shounen manga with the perceptiveness, struggle, and growth you find in seinen MCs. He has streaks of optimistic goodie two-shoes, but he also gets angry, frustrated, and even resentful at things/people like any reasonable person would.
